28 lines
711 B
Rust
28 lines
711 B
Rust
// use rand::{rngs::ThreadRng, thread_rng};
|
|
// use silentPayments::secp256k1::{self, Secp256k1, SecretKey};
|
|
|
|
// use sp_backend::SpClient;
|
|
/*
|
|
pub struct Wallet {
|
|
pub client: SpClient,
|
|
pub secp: Secp256k1<secp256k1::All>,
|
|
pub seckey_spend: SecretKey,
|
|
pub seckey_scan: SecretKey,
|
|
}
|
|
|
|
impl Wallet {
|
|
pub fn new() -> Wallet {
|
|
let secp: Secp256k1<secp256k1::All> = Secp256k1::new();
|
|
let mut rng: ThreadRng = thread_rng();
|
|
let seckey_spend: SecretKey = SecretKey::new(rng);
|
|
let seckey_scan: SecretKey = SecretKey::new(rng);
|
|
Wallet {
|
|
client: SpClient::new(),
|
|
secp,
|
|
seckey_spend,
|
|
seckey_scan,
|
|
}
|
|
}
|
|
}
|
|
*/
|